Nothing Lionel Messi does surprises us any more but we thought he might at least take a go or two before absolutely nailing this.
The Barcelona ace was putting his skills to the test for a Japanese TV programme by attempting to kick a football 60 feet in the air, over a beam, before controlling it on the other side and sending it back over the target and controlling once more.
And the Argentina captain makes it look depressingly simple.
